Normally I am running around on a weekend like a headless chook but last weekend I decided to pull my finger out and go and see a few of the new shows that have sprung up around town.

First cab off the rank was Razzle Dazzle at the Newtown Hotel on Friday, starring Chelsea, Amelia, Kitty and a very young dancer.

We were treated to a visual spectacular, with everyone dancing up a storm on the postage-stamp-size stage. The girls soon had the crowd screaming for more -¦ well, as much as the Newtown crowds scream. They are known as a non-clapping crowd but still love the shows so who knows?

My next stop was the brand new Kylie show on Saturday night at the Midnight Shift. (Incidentally, my Kylie show at the Palace will be staying on Saturday nights, not moving to Thursdays as reported last week.)

This show is an extravaganza, but what else would we expect from this DIVA-winning cast? It stars Amelia, Joyce, Ashley, Marcello, Marcus and reigning Entertainer of the Year Minnie Cooper making her first appearance in the Queen cast.

The big budget show had me standing up the back wide-eyed in excitement the whole time. It features huge backpacks, a butterfly and a huge rideable penis -“ now that’s got your attention -“ and all the boys are wearing practically nothing for the whole show. Trust me when I say, you have to see it.

Still needing a drag fix on Sunday, I decided to take myself off to Arq to see Mitzi’s new show, Lie Back And Think Of England, starring Mitzi, Wyness, Farren, Alex and the always-sexy Marcello.

To say Mitzi did a bloody great job would be an understatement. The show is a tribute to the fabulous TV program Little Britain and if you love the television show you will love this show. I have a very soft spot for one character, Marjorie Dawes, and I was left giggling in delight.

With characters such as Vicki Pollard, Mitzi proves that practice makes perfect -“ god, she really must have some free time on her hands. Farren Heit’s Anne was so realistic that it had the audience hooting.

My bed was looking very good by the end of the weekend. If you love to watch great shows and you can’t possibly get to see one of mine, there’s three of the best to hit stages around town.
